ORDER OF COUNCILLOR JOHN M. TOBIN, JR.
WHEREAS: The Inspectional Services Department issues permits to property owners for new construction and additions to existing structures; and
WHEREAS: Any project in compliance with that neighborhood’s zoning code is termed an “as of right” project; and
WHEREAS: Permits are issued for “as of right” projects with minimal notification to abutters; and
WHEREAS: That lack of notification often leads to confusion within neighborhoods because residents do not know what is happening on their street; and
WHEREAS: A sign on the property indicating what is being built and with contact information for Inspectional Services would better inform neighbors on the construction; Therefore be it
ORDERED: That the appropriate committee of the Boston City Council conduct a hearing to discuss ways to better inform residents to “as of right” projects in their neighborhood and that the Inspectional Services Department, other appropriate agencies, and members of the public be invited to testify.
Filed in City Council: Wednesday, August 23, 2006
